How decisions get made

- [Lecturer] Now this is the $18 trillion question. How do decisions get made? It's often easy to question a decision in hindsight, but the nuance of decision-making is that it's often difficult. There's a lot of pressure to be right, and depending on your organization, when you're wrong, everyone knows about it. Organizations and the units within typically make decisions through a combination of individual and group decision-making processes or frameworks, which are well-established, and, I'll guess, well-intentioned. The actual decision-making process you use may be driven based on the size, structure, culture, and industry of your organization. However, there are some common methods used. As I go through them, think about examples of that decision-making approach in your organization. First, we have the hierarchical decision-making method.
